Balkåkra socken
Balkåkra socken is a locality in Ljunits, Ystad Municipality, Scania. Balkåkra socken is situated nearby to the hamlet Marsvinsholm, as well as near the village Svarte.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Charlottenlund Castle
Castle
Photo: Jorchr,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Charlottenlund Castle is a castle in Ystad Municipality, Scania, in southern Sweden. Charlottenlund is located 5 miles west of Ystad. The castle was built in 1849 in Gothic Revival style, with an open courtyard with a gallery.
